A couple of Moringa Facts:
Moringa Oleifera Leaf is a superfood that may be eaten contemporary or powdered and utilized in some ways. It can also be the MOST NUTRIENT DENSE FOOD ON THE PLANET! The leaves of the tree alone comprise:
46 Antioxidants
39 Anti-Inflammatories
18 – Amino Acids (8 of these are important amino acids out physique would not produce!)
23% Protein by weight
More potassium than Bananas
More Vitamin A than Carrots
The solely plant to comprise Zeatin – An Anti-Aging Hormone that helps reproduce mitochondria giving your physique power on the cell stage!
